## Changelog 2.9.0 — Cold start defaults

Heads up, new folks: Fennelwork handlers now keep two warm instances per function by default, so cold starts should mostly vanish in staging. Memory floor also bumped, which shaved init time noticeably. If your function was relying on the old lazy behavior, check your overrides. The new default configuration values are shown below.

settings of bahaf-hadup:
RALIX_PIN=6433
RALIX_METRICS_HOST=metrics.ralix.qirvancorp.corp
RALIX_LOG_LEVEL=error
RALIX_TENANT=druir

New starter, night desk, Oakhollow Tower:

- Greet every visitor; no exceptions after 20:00.
- Check photo ID against the overnight visitor list from the Ferrow & Blane duty sheet.
- Log arrival time, host name, and floor in the desk register.
- Issue a temporary visitor lanyard; collect it on exit.
- Never buzz anyone through unescorted. Call the host to collect them.
- If the host is unreachable, visitor waits in the lobby.
- To release the inner lobby door for escorted visitors, use the code below.

turnstile pass: bdg-TXR-4

Hey, welcome to reviewing the Velvetine seat-map renderer. Most PRs touch the SVG layout engine for the Orpheum Hall project, but you'll occasionally see config changes too. The renderer pulls pricing tiers from the box-office API at startup, so a local .env is required: set VENUE_ID to ORP-01, CACHE_TTL to 300, and RENDER_SCALE to 2 for retina previews. Keep diffs to config minimal and flagged. Right under RENDER_SCALE goes the box-office API secret.

sealed setting: ARCHIVE_KEY3=8d0